Minnesota Health Care Programs

1.5 Mandatory Verifications

Each Minnesota Health Care Program (MHCP) has specific verification requirements. Refer to the program sections for detailed information about mandatory verifications.

The agency must first attempt to use electronic data sources to verify information provided by the applicant or enrollee. If electronic verification is unsuccessful or unavailable, paper proofs may be required. In some circumstances, self-attestation is acceptable without further verification. Refer to specific eligibility requirements for information on what types of proofs may verify information and when self-attestation is acceptable.

For certain eligibility factors, verification must occur pre-eligibility is approved. For other eligibility factors, verification can be completed post-eligibility, after eligibility is approved.

In addition to mandatory verifications, proofs may be required for other eligibility factors when the information provided by the applicant or enrollee is inconsistent with information the county, tribal or state servicing agency has from other sources. See 1.3.2.4 MHCP Inconsistent Information policy for more information about situations when proofs may be required.

Applicants and enrollees are primarily responsible for providing required paper proofs. However, agencies must assist applicants and enrollees in obtaining proof if the person is unable to provide it. Do not deny or close eligibility for people who are making a good faith effort to obtain the required proofs.

County, tribal and state servicing agencies must retain verification documentation in accordance with the County Human Service Records Retention Schedule (DHS-6928)
